Output 7f840d64a3c8110992785f45383f2e2f73aea898129c9b2ed654b0349e0df2f4:1

value
424506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 217d2fa3e9128b440bdde9f48c04c8db9d84895b OP_EQUAL
address
34k6BxRxxhJpbSvJMoF6PhCHSuBpiHNMvQ
transaction
7f840d64a3c8110992785f45383f2e2f73aea898129c9b2ed654b0349e0df2f4